This interactive two-hour online workshop will explore the core principles of best practice in patient and public involvement.

It is designed for NHS staff, particularly those in research, as well as members of the public interested in learning about patient and public involvement in health and social care research.

After this workshop, you will:

  • Understand what ‘public involvement in research’ is and why it is important
  • Understand the difference between patient and public involvement, engagement and participation
  • Know how to involve patients and the public at every stage of the research cycle
  • Learn about the NIHR Standards for Involvement and how to incorporate these into practice
  • Know where to find key PPI resources and information
